Punnett squares use the alleles of gametes to determine the genotypes and phenotypes of all possible offspring.

Two laws of probability apply to genetics. The product rile states that the chance of two events occurring together is equal to the multiplied probabilities of each of those two events occurring individually.

The sum rule adds individual probabilities to determine the mutual probability for an event.

When events are described with the word "and", the product rule is used. Events described using the word "or" often use the sum rule.

The results of one-trait and two-trait crosses, depending upon the alleles of the gametes, have certain characteristic ratios that describe the genotypes and phenotypes of the offspring.

The sum rule is used to determine this value when the results of each individual probabilities are added.

Skin color and height are examples of polygenic traits that are controlled by multiple sets of alleles.

Polygenic traits are graphically represented as a bell curve.
